I have KC Hilites Daylighters they are 6" round lights. I went with Stainless Steel because of the look/durability issue as well. They are the long range version and will throw light well OVER 1 mile. I've had mine through one winter with about 50 hours of total use and they're AWESOME so far. The KC kit comes with everything you need to hookem up. I paid $140 for the SS set of 6" Daylighters...they are the "premium" model with the shock mounts and are the 130w version, they make 100w and 150w as well. Different price of course.

I also couldn't find any CP info on the Di ck Cepek lights, and I know that wattage doesn't always matter so that is what kind of sucks. You could have a 150W light and a 55w light but if the reflector, etc is crap on the 150W then the 55W could actually throw off more CP.
